• Najnowsze pytania
  • Bez odpowiedzi
  • Zadaj pytanie
  • Kategorie
  • Tagi
  • Zdobyte punkty
  • Ekipa ninja
  • IRC
  • FAQ
  • Regulamin
  • Książki warte uwagi

question-closed SQL CREATE SYNONYM

VPS Starter Arubacloud
0 głosów
93 wizyt
pytanie zadane 30 października 2020 w SQL, bazy danych przez Sebastian Szyja Bywalec (2,810 p.)
zamknięte 30 października 2020 przez Sebastian Szyja

Siemanko posaidam taki kodzik:

<?php

    $docelowaDB = $_POST['docelowaDB'];
    $docelowaTBL = $_POST['docelowaTBL'];
    $docelowaNAME = $_POST['docelowaNAME'];


    $database = $_POST['dbname'];
    require_once('../../config_database_without_dbname.php');
               
    $sql = "CREATE SYNONYM dbo.$docelowaNAME FOR $docelowaDB.dbo.$docelowaTBL; GO";         
    try {
        $conn->exec($sql);
        echo json_encode(array("statusCode"=>200));
    } catch (PDOException $e) {
        echo json_encode(array("statusCode"=>201));
    }
     
?>

Ale niestety nie działą :(( Macie pomysł jak za pomocą PHP stworzyć synonim na bazie danych?

komentarz zamknięcia: Problem rozwiązany

1 odpowiedź

0 głosów
odpowiedź 30 października 2020 przez Sebastian Szyja Bywalec (2,810 p.)

Znalazłem odpowiedź :)

<?php

    $docelowaDB = $_POST['docelowaDB'];
    $docelowaTBL = $_POST['docelowaTBL'];
    $docelowaNAME = $_POST['docelowaNAME'];


    $database = $_POST['dbname'];
    require_once('../../config_database_without_dbname.php');
               
    $sql = "CREATE SYNONYM dbo.$docelowaNAME FOR $docelowaDB.dbo.$docelowaTBL";         
    try {
        $conn->exec($sql);
        echo json_encode(array("statusCode"=>200));
    } catch (PDOException $e) {
        echo json_encode(array("statusCode"=>201));
    }
     
?>

 

Podobne pytania

0 głosów
0 odpowiedzi 389 wizyt
pytanie zadane 18 marca 2020 w Nasze poradniki przez oracledev Użytkownik (620 p.)
0 głosów
1 odpowiedź 802 wizyt
pytanie zadane 13 maja 2020 w SQL, bazy danych przez Mavimix Dyskutant (8,420 p.)
0 głosów
1 odpowiedź 645 wizyt
pytanie zadane 11 kwietnia 2017 w SQL, bazy danych przez dervil Gaduła (3,030 p.)

93,020 zapytań

141,983 odpowiedzi

321,283 komentarzy

62,366 pasjonatów

Motyw:

Akcja Pajacyk

Pajacyk od wielu lat dożywia dzieci. Pomóż klikając w zielony brzuszek na stronie. Dziękujemy! ♡

Oto polecana książka warta uwagi.
Pełną listę książek znajdziesz tutaj

Wprowadzenie do ITsec, tom 2

Można już zamawiać tom 2 książki "Wprowadzenie do bezpieczeństwa IT" - będzie to około 650 stron wiedzy o ITsec (17 rozdziałów, 14 autorów, kolorowy druk).

Planowana premiera: 30.09.2024, zaś planowana wysyłka nastąpi w drugim tygodniu października 2024.

Warto preorderować, tym bardziej, iż mamy dla Was kod: pasja (użyjcie go w koszyku), dzięki któremu uzyskamy dodatkowe 15% zniżki! Dziękujemy zaprzyjaźnionej ekipie Sekuraka za kod dla naszej Społeczności!

...